Subject: Cut-over complete — strict pinning on Marrowlane CI

Hi on-call team,

The Marrowlane pipeline was cut over to the strict dependency pinning policy this morning. All builds now resolve solely from committed lockfiles; floating ranges fail fast with a clear error. If a build pages you tonight, check for stale lockfiles first. For reference during the watch period, the active resolver configuration is reproduced below.

settings of fafog-haduf:
ZORIX_PIN=4648
ZORIX_METRICS_HOST=metrics.zorix.paliqsys.corp
ZORIX_LOG_LEVEL=info
ZORIX_TENANT=druix

/*
 * SCANWEDGE_PROTOCOL_VERSION
 *
 * Pins the handshake version used by the Lintquay barcode
 * scanner bridge. Firmware below rev 7 on Ostermere units
 * rejects newer framing, so bump this only alongside a
 * coordinated firmware rollout. Release manager: confirm the
 * warehouse pilot sign-off before shipping any change here.
 * The bridge build this constant was certified against is:
 */

trace token, kawip-fafog: htk14_26e64c4d35154e

Welcome to the Liftgrid team. Liftgrid simulates elevator dispatch under configurable traffic profiles. Core loop: ingest call events, run the assignment solver, emit car movements. Don't touch the solver without a sim regression run. Setup takes ~20 minutes. Architecture notes, local build steps, and scenario files are on the internal page below.

wiki page, bagaf-fawip: https://harbor.tolvaqsys.local/pages/repo/pages/secrets/eac969ffc71f356b